
Take Back Your Book
Katlyn Duncan
Revive your book from the bottom of the charts with rights reversion.
Have you sold your book to a publisher, but years later it’s not selling the way you want? Are you frustrated with their lack of marketing and little to no royalty payments?
It’s time to take back your book rights.
This guide will give you the knowledge and confidence to get your book rights reverted and how to place it in front of new readers, on your terms.
In this book you’ll find:
You will always be your book's biggest champion. Don't condemn it to years of neglect at someone else's hands. Take back your rights and make them work for you for years to come.
